The Atriums have perforated Titan mesh stock (different from the radial mesh). Solid mesh will attenuate the upper mids/lower treble. I recently switched back to the solid mesh, as I find it pairs better when using the Ultra Perf Caldera pads.

I like swapping pads, particularly between caldera ultra perf and universe, although other options sometimes appeal too.
I had been using the solid mesh for a while, enjoying the smoothness of the sound. But I started to find it was a little too smoothed off with the universe pads.
An almost perfect combination is the stock atrium mesh with the caldera pads. It just made me smile, how good it was. But when I now use the stock mesh with the Universe pads (as I love, LOVE the universe pads' staging) I find the lower treble very slightly still too smoothed.
So another almost perfect combination I have found is the universe pads with the radial mesh. I'm getting the universe staging with a bit of the added clarity that the caldera pads bring. It doesn't quite fully deliver the dynamics and better resolution of the Caldera pads but it gets close on the clarity.
I think that the radial mesh with the Caldera pads is a little too hot but still very listenable. I may give that more of chance too from time to time. My tastes have been evolving lately, but as someone who also enjoys grados and the Arya V2, this pad/mesh combo is still well within the acceptable limits of brightness.
I've said this before but no mesh doesn't work for me. Too much treble not enough separation and definition.
So it seems I'm going to be jumping between stock perforated mesh and radial mesh and universe and caldera pads for the foreseeable future.... Until Zach one day decides to throw an ultra perf unverse pad into the mix or some other disruptor.
Lots of fun still to be had with the Atriums
